&quot;But we&#x27;d probably end up discussing it in the same channel where once we were talking about the hot new restaurant down the street or posting pictures of cool explosions.&quot;<p>If you&#x27;re talking about production bugs and restaurants and explosions in the same slack channel then the problem is not with slack, it&#x27;s with the teams communication style.<p>We have #general and #random channels for these exact conversions. Why can&#x27;t you create a #restaurants or #explosions channel? Hell, we even have a #giphy channel that is reserved for all gifs. This helps us keep cat gifs out of our important conversions. All of our development communication happens in #engineering or #frontend. We don&#x27;t experience the problems the author is ranting about at all.<p>Regarding threads: what happens when the site goes down and suddenly 5 different engineers create a thread about it. Now you have 5 different conversations trying to debug what just went wrong. Do you merge the threads? What happens if you need to split a thread into two conversations? I get that threads are good in certain contexts, but to me it&#x27;s just more complexity switching between multiple threads.<p>It&#x27;s not the tool that&#x27;s broken. It sounds like the author needs to communicate to others that certain conversations are meant for certain channels, and they need to enforce that rule when it doesn&#x27;t happen.

I think Salesforce Chatter is a good implementation of this. Basically any object in Salesforce (cases, contacts, any custom object like bug reports) has a chatter feed attached to it where people can post and reply. Its got functional @mentions and file attachment. There are also generic Group feeds for communication with a group of people not relating to a specific object.<p>However, it&#x27;s more of a comment thread than a real time chat application. You have to refresh the page to see new updates. Also since there is no where to &quot;hang out,&quot; it&#x27;s hard to talk to someone directly. Sometimes you post and have to @mention three of four groups to find someone to respond.
